Patents by Inventor Stephen WILKE
Stephen WILKE has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 12262456Abstract: A method and apparatus for an indoor horticultural system that utilizes a wired network to control lighting. The wired interface is used to relay both analog and digital intensity control information, whereby an analog signal is used to control the intensity of all LED arrays in each lighting fixture during a first mode of operation and a digital signal is used to control the intensity of each individual LED array in each lighting fixture in a second mode of operation. Both the analog and digital signals utilize the same physical interface.Type: GrantFiled: January 22, 2022Date of Patent: March 25, 2025Assignee: Scynce LED LLCInventors: Stephen P Adams, Arthur A. Wilkes, Jay B. Norrish
-
Publication number: 20250028766Abstract: A data-driven, unsupervised system (“owner inference module”) has been created that collects information from different data sources and infers ownership of an asset by discerning signals conveying ownership and using them to identify likely owners of assets. The owner inference module creates a graph of direct and indirect relationships among the asset and entities based on the collected information (i.e., the data and metadata). The owner inference module processes the graph and accounts for the varying strengths of different ownership signals based on any one or more of observations, expert knowledge, and preferences. The owner inference module quantifies the different signals of ownership of an entity and aggregates these values into an ownership likelihood score.Type: ApplicationFiled: July 17, 2023Publication date: January 23, 2025Inventors: Pamela Lynn Toman, Andrew Clayton Scott, Johnathan Daniel Wilkes, Aaron Mark Isaksen, Matthew Stephen Kraning, Gregory David Heon
-
Publication number: 20240104868Abstract: Methods, systems, and apparatus, including computer programs encoded on computer storage media, for generating composite images. One of the methods includes maintaining first data associating each location within an environment with a particular time; obtaining an image depicting the environment from a point of view of a display device; obtaining second data characterizing one or more virtual objects; and processing the obtained image and the second data to generate a composite image depicting the one or more virtual objects at respective locations in the environment from the point of view of the display device, wherein the composite image depicts each virtual object according to the particular time that the first data associates with the location of the virtual object in the environment.Type: ApplicationFiled: December 5, 2023Publication date: March 28, 2024Inventor: Stephen Wilkes
-
Patent number: 11861798Abstract: Methods, systems, and apparatus, including computer programs encoded on computer storage media, for generating composite images. One of the methods includes maintaining first data associating each location within an environment with a particular time; obtaining an image depicting the environment from a point of view of a display device; obtaining second data characterizing one or more virtual objects; and processing the obtained image and the second data to generate a composite image depicting the one or more virtual objects at respective locations in the environment from the point of view of the display device, wherein the composite image depicts each virtual object according to the particular time that the first data associates with the location of the virtual object in the environment.Type: GrantFiled: July 26, 2021Date of Patent: January 2, 2024Inventor: Stephen Wilkes
-
Patent number: 11544395Abstract: A system and method for providing transactional data privacy while maintaining data usability, including the use of different obfuscation functions for different data types to securely obfuscate the data, in real-time, while maintaining its statistical characteristics. In accordance with an embodiment, the system comprises an obfuscation process that captures data while it is being received in the form of data changes at a first or source system, selects one or more obfuscation techniques to be used with the data according to the type of data captured, and obfuscates the data, using the selected one or more obfuscation techniques, to create an obfuscated data, for use in generating a trail file containing the obfuscated data, or applying the data changes to a target or second system.Type: GrantFiled: December 2, 2020Date of Patent: January 3, 2023Assignee: ORACLE INTERNATIONAL CORPORATIONInventors: Shenoda Guirguis, Alok Pareek, Stephen Wilkes
-
Publication number: 20220108531Abstract: Methods, systems, and apparatus, including computer programs encoded on computer storage media, for generating composite images. One of the methods includes maintaining first data associating each location within an environment with a particular time; obtaining an image depicting the environment from a point of view of a display device; obtaining second data characterizing one or more virtual objects; and processing the obtained image and the second data to generate a composite image depicting the one or more virtual objects at respective locations in the environment from the point of view of the display device, wherein the composite image depicts each virtual object according to the particular time that the first data associates with the location of the virtual object in the environment.Type: ApplicationFiled: July 26, 2021Publication date: April 7, 2022Inventor: Stephen Wilkes
-
Patent number: 11050101Abstract: A method and apparatus for determining and/or monitoring a thermal state of charge or melt fraction of phase change material in a battery system. The battery system includes a plurality of electrochemical cell elements, a supply of a phase change material in thermal contact with the plurality of electrochemical cell elements, and a battery management system that monitors a thermal storage capacity of the phase change material and automatically controls a power of the plurality of electrochemical cell elements as a function of the thermal storage capacity of the phase change material. The battery management system automatically adjusts a power output of the plurality of electrochemical cell elements as a function of the thermal storage capacity of the phase change material to provide a heat output within a predetermined safe temperature limit.Type: GrantFiled: January 9, 2018Date of Patent: June 29, 2021Assignee: ALL CELL TECHNOLOGIES, LLCInventors: Said Al-Hallaj, Mohamad M. Salameh, Siddique Ali Khateeb Razack, Benjamin Schweitzer, Stephen Wilke, Mahesh Krishnamurthy
-
Publication number: 20210089669Abstract: A system and method for providing transactional data privacy while maintaining data usability, including the use of different obfuscation functions for different data types to securely obfuscate the data, in real-time, while maintaining its statistical characteristics. In accordance with an embodiment, the system comprises an obfuscation process that captures data while it is being received in the form of data changes at a first or source system, selects one or more obfuscation techniques to be used with the data according to the type of data captured, and obfuscates the data, using the selected one or more obfuscation techniques, to create an obfuscated data, for use in generating a trail file containing the obfuscated data, or applying the data changes to a target or second system.Type: ApplicationFiled: December 2, 2020Publication date: March 25, 2021Inventors: Shenoda Guirguis, Alok Pareek, Stephen Wilkes
-
Patent number: 10860732Abstract: A system and method for providing transactional data privacy while maintaining data usability, including the use of different obfuscation functions for different data types to securely obfuscate the data, in real-time, while maintaining its statistical characteristics. In accordance with an embodiment, the system comprises an obfuscation process that captures data while it is being received in the form of data changes at a first or source system, selects one or more obfuscation techniques to be used with the data according to the type of data captured, and obfuscates the data, using the selected one or more obfuscation techniques, to create an obfuscated data, for use in generating a trail file containing the obfuscated data, or applying the data changes to a target or second system.Type: GrantFiled: October 28, 2015Date of Patent: December 8, 2020Assignee: ORACLE INTERNATIONAL CORPORATIONInventors: Shenoda Guirguis, Alok Pareek, Stephen Wilkes
-
Publication number: 20200235446Abstract: A method and apparatus for determining and/or monitoring a thermal state of charge or melt fraction of phase change material in a battery system. The battery system includes a plurality of electrochemical cell elements, a supply of a phase change material in thermal contact with the plurality of electrochemical cell elements, and a battery management system that monitors a thermal storage capacity of the phase change material and automatically controls a power of the plurality of electrochemical cell elements as a function of the thermal storage capacity of the phase change material. The battery management system automatically adjusts a power output of the plurality of electrochemical cell elements as a function of the thermal storage capacity of the phase change material to provide a heat output within a predetermined safe temperature limit.Type: ApplicationFiled: January 9, 2018Publication date: July 23, 2020Applicant: ALL CELL TECHNOLOGIES, LLCInventors: Said Al-HALLAJ, Mohamad M. SALAMEH, Siddique Ali KHATEEB RAZACK, Benjamin SCHWEITZER, Stephen WILKE, Mahesh KRISHNAMURTHY
-
Patent number: 9298878Abstract: A system and method for providing transactional data privacy while maintaining data usability, including the use of different obfuscation functions for different data types to securely obfuscate the data, in real-time, while maintaining its statistical characteristics. In accordance with an embodiment, the system comprises an obfuscation process that captures data while it is being received in the form of data changes at a first or source system, selects one or more obfuscation techniques to be used with the data according to the type of data captured, and obfuscates the data, using the selected one or more obfuscation techniques, to create an obfuscated data, for use in generating a trail file containing the obfuscated data, or applying the data changes to a target or second system.Type: GrantFiled: March 31, 2011Date of Patent: March 29, 2016Assignee: ORACLE INTERNATIONAL CORPORATIONInventors: Shenoda Guirguis, Alok Pareek, Stephen Wilkes
-
Publication number: 20160085982Abstract: A system and method for providing transactional data privacy while maintaining data usability, including the use of different obfuscation functions for different data types to securely obfuscate the data, in real-time, while maintaining its statistical characteristics. In accordance with an embodiment, the system comprises an obfuscation process that captures data while it is being received in the form of data changes at a first or source system, selects one or more obfuscation techniques to be used with the data according to the type of data captured, and obfuscates the data, using the selected one or more obfuscation techniques, to create an obfuscated data, for use in generating a trail file containing the obfuscated data, or applying the data changes to a target or second system.Type: ApplicationFiled: October 28, 2015Publication date: March 24, 2016Inventors: Shenoda Guirguis, Alok Pareek, Stephen Wilkes
-
Patent number: 9251311Abstract: A system and method for providing transactional data privacy while maintaining data usability, including the use of different obfuscation functions for different data types to securely obfuscate the data, in real-time, while maintaining its statistical characteristics. In accordance with an embodiment, the system comprises an obfuscation process that captures data while it is being received in the form of data changes at a first or source system, selects one or more obfuscation techniques to be used with the data according to the type of data captured, and obfuscates the data, using the selected one or more obfuscation techniques, to create an obfuscated data, for use in generating a trail file containing the obfuscated data, or applying the data changes to a target or second system.Type: GrantFiled: March 31, 2011Date of Patent: February 2, 2016Assignee: ORACLE INTENATIONAL CORPORATIONInventors: Shenoda Guirguis, Alok Pareek, Stephen Wilkes
-
Patent number: 9047392Abstract: A system and method for performing real-time conversion of data which is present in the form of messages on JMS-compliant or other messaging systems into database transactions; which can then subsequently be applied to multiple heterogeneous databases or other systems. In accordance with an embodiment, the invention provides a means by which data can be read from messages in a messaging system, and converted to a set of database operations that are then stored as a persistent trail file. The operations can then be routed via a network and applied to target systems as required, for example to maintain a replicated set of information at one or more different or heterogeneous systems. The data in the message can be formatted in a variety of ways, for example, as fixed width, delimited, or XML data, and the system can be configured to convert this data as appropriate.Type: GrantFiled: December 5, 2013Date of Patent: June 2, 2015Assignee: ORACLE INTERNATIONAL CORPORATIONInventors: Stephen Wilkes, Michael Scott Nielsen, Codin Pora
-
Publication number: 20140172886Abstract: A system and method for performing real-time conversion of data which is present in the form of messages on JMS-compliant or other messaging systems into database transactions; which can then subsequently be applied to multiple heterogeneous databases or other systems. In accordance with an embodiment, the invention provides a means by which data can be read from messages in a messaging system, and converted to a set of database operations that are then stored as a persistent trail file. The operations can then be routed via a network and applied to target systems as required, for example to maintain a replicated set of information at one or more different or heterogeneous systems. The data in the message can be formatted in a variety of ways, for example, as fixed width, delimited, or XML data, and the system can be configured to convert this data as appropriate.Type: ApplicationFiled: December 5, 2013Publication date: June 19, 2014Applicant: Oracle International CorporationInventors: Stephen Wilkes, Michael Scott Nielsen, Codin Pora
-
Patent number: 8626778Abstract: A system and method for performing real-time conversion of data which is present in the form of messages on JMS-compliant or other messaging systems into database transactions, which can then subsequently be applied to multiple heterogeneous databases or other systems. In accordance with an embodiment, the invention provides a means by which data can be read from messages, and converted to a set of database operations that are then stored as a persistent trail file (for example, as an Oracle GoldenGate trail file). The operations, as recorded in the trail file, can then be routed via a network and applied to target systems as required. In accordance with an embodiment, the data can be read in real-time from the messaging system, and written out as quickly as it can be consumed to the persistent trail files.Type: GrantFiled: March 30, 2011Date of Patent: January 7, 2014Assignee: Oracle International CorporationInventors: Stephen Wilkes, Michael Scott Nielsen, Codin Pora
-
Publication number: 20120030165Abstract: A system and method for providing transactional data privacy while maintaining data usability, including the use of different obfuscation functions for different data types to securely obfuscate the data, in real-time, while maintaining its statistical characteristics. In accordance with an embodiment, the system comprises an obfuscation process that captures data while it is being received in the form of data changes at a first or source system, selects one or more obfuscation techniques to be used with the data according to the type of data captured, and obfuscates the data, using the selected one or more obfuscation techniques, to create an obfuscated data, for use in generating a trail file containing the obfuscated data, or applying the data changes to a target or second system.Type: ApplicationFiled: March 31, 2011Publication date: February 2, 2012Applicant: ORACLE INTERNATIONAL CORPORATIONInventors: Shenoda Guirguis, Alok Pareek, Stephen Wilkes
-
Publication number: 20120023116Abstract: A system and method for performing real-time conversion of data which is present in the form of messages on JMS-compliant or other messaging systems into database transactions, which can then subsequently be applied to multiple heterogeneous databases or other systems. In accordance with an embodiment, the invention provides a means by which data can be read from messages in a messaging system, and converted to a set of database operations that are then stored as a persistent trail file (for example, as an Oracle GoldenGate trail file). The operations, as recorded in the trail file, can then be routed via a network and applied to target systems as required, for example to maintain a replicated set of information at one or more different or heterogeneous systems. The data in the message can be formatted in a variety of ways, for example, as fixed width, delimited, or XML data, and the system can be configured to convert this data as appropriate.Type: ApplicationFiled: March 30, 2011Publication date: January 26, 2012Applicant: ORACLE INTERNATIONAL CORPORATIONInventors: Stephen Wilkes, Michael Scott Nielsen, Codin Pora
-
Publication number: 20060128609Abstract: Described herein are N?-acylated derivatives of desleucylA82846B. The compounds are useful as antibacterial agents.Type: ApplicationFiled: September 2, 2005Publication date: June 15, 2006Applicant: Eli Lilly and CompanyInventors: Richard Thompson, Stephen Wilkes
-
Publication number: 20020169789Abstract: A system and method for accessing, organizing, and presenting data are described. A first user interface area is presented to enable a user to define a data reference structure for one or more data sources from multiple disparate data sources, the one or more data sources containing data to be provided to the user. A second user interface area is presented to enable the user to create one or more data structures corresponding to the data reference structure and connected to the one or more data sources. A third user interface area is presented to enable the user to define application business logic to be performed on data in connection with the one or more data structures. A fourth user interface area is presented to enable the user to create presentation logic to display data in an output view. Finally, a fifth user interface area is presented to enable the user to define an action that triggers the application business logic.Type: ApplicationFiled: June 5, 2001Publication date: November 14, 2002Inventors: Ali Kutay, Cihan Akin, Eliahu Albek, Erhan C. Akin, Hakan Akin, John Gilbert, Stephen Wilkes